Nikon India Pvt. Ltd. Vs DCIT (ITAT Delhi)

The issue under consideration is whether the assessment will sustain even if the Assessing Officer ignoring the statutory provisions of section 144C, passed the Final assessment order without issuing draft assessment order to the assessee?

In the present case, the Tribunal vide order dated 31.03.2017 remanded the matter back to the TPO/AO for fresh determination. Thus, as per Section 144C of the Act, it is mandatory for the Assessing Officer to pass draft Assessment Order. But instead of that, the Assessing Officer vide order dated 18.10.2019 merely captioned the final Assessment Order as Draft Assessment Order along with issuance of notices under Section 156 and 274 read with Section 271(1)(c) of the Act which means a final Assessment order u/s 144C was passed without following the mandatory provisions of Section 144C of the Act.

All pronounce decisions highlighted that final Assessment order passed in remand proceedings without passing a draft Assessment order is in violation of Section 144C of the Act and is therefore null and void. The Ld. DR could not bring any case law on contrary to these decisions. In fact, the statute itself gives a mandatory direction to the Assessing Officer under Section 144C that in the first instance the Assessing Officer should forward the draft of the proposed order of assessment. Thus, the Assessment order itself is bad in law and void ab initio, hence quashed. Hence, appeal filed by the assessee is allowed.
